The condition of a property plays an important role in determining its value, with the degree of impact varying by property type, size and location.
For 70, Hart Road, Manchester, we estimate a market value of £272,055 and a rental value of £1,580 per month when presented in very good decorative order. Should the property require extensive cosmetic improvement, those figures would reduce to £240,963 and £1,400 per month respectively.

Energy Efficiency
70, Hart Road, Manchester has an Energy Performance Rating (EPC) of D. This is based on the most recent assessment, dated 11 Dec 2024.
The property is connected to mains gas and has fully double glazed windows. It is heated using a boiler and radiators (mains gas).
